The SSS test is one of the congruency tests in geometry. It stands for Side-Side-Side. The test states that if the three sides of one triangle are congruent to the three sides of another triangle, then the two triangles are congruent.

In the statement By the SSS test, ABC ≅ DEF, we can infer that:

– ABC and DEF are two separate triangles
– The three sides of ABC are congruent to the three sides of DEF
– Therefore, ABC and DEF are congruent

So, we can say that ABC and DEF are identical in shape and size. The abbreviation ≅ means congruent to. Therefore, we can write ABC ≅ DEF to indicate this fact.

Note that when we say two triangles are congruent, we mean that all their corresponding parts (sides and angles) are equal. This implies that if we place one triangle on top of the other, they will perfectly overlap with each other.
